Virgil van Dijk insists Liverpool are paying no attention to their lead over Manchester City in the Premier League title race.
The Reds moved eight points clear at the top after they beat Leicester City and City lost to Wolves over the weekend.
"So far we have been getting the points," he told Sky Sports.
"There is always room for improvement in our game. And I think we should just focus on all the games ahead of us and don't look at any gaps or points or difference between us and the others, including City.
"There are a lot of busy periods coming up as well with December and January and anything can happen still."
